Find the percentage of the top six sales neighborhoods in terms of the sum of the top six sales, respectively, as shown below.
The top six neighborhoods in terms of sales are first filtered and then implemented by adding calculation indicator.
Use the demo data "Store sales statistics" to create the component.
1)Drag the dimension "Area2" into the horizontal axis and the indicator "Sales" into the vertical axis, and select the chart type as grouped table, as shown below.
2)Click "Area2", select drop-down > Filter, click Add Conditions in the filter settings box that pops up in the system, filter out the top six sales Area2, and click OK. As shown in the figure below.
1)Drag in the indicator field "Sales" and click on the dropdown > Quick Calculation > Share, as shown below.
2)The grouping table is shown below.
1)Add the calculation indicator, add the indicator name "Top six each Area2 as a percentage of top six Area2" for the indicator, and enter the formula as shown below.
Two functions, SUM_AGG and TOTAL, are used in this formula. For details on SUM_AGG, see SUM_AGG; for details on TOTAL, see Quick Calculation Functions.
2)Drag this calculated indicator into the indicator column of the analysis area, as shown in the following figure.
3)For this calculation indicator, select the drop-down>Value format, and follow the same procedure as in Chapter 2.2. The following figure shows.
The percentages of each of the first six Areas2 to the first six Areas2 are shown in the figure below.
